This book provides an introduction to observations made at the Dorpat Observatory in 1823, and a discussion of their significance within the field of astronomy. The author provides the reader with a historical context by reviewing the initial steps taken by astronomers to understand the universe, beginning with the work of Tycho Brahe, and the subsequent refinement of Tycho's ideas and observational tools by Johannes Kepler. This book will appeal to historians of science, individuals interested in the field of astronomy, and those looking for a deeper understanding of the methods, tools, and breakthroughs that have helped scholars understand astronomy.
